We are currently seeking a Hydro Engineering Assistant Project Manager to function as embedded/augmented Client staff. Individual will sit in the client office 5 days/week and report to the Project Manager(s) to implement improvement projects on the hydropower facility fleet.
Duties:
Assists Avangrid Project Managers in managing office administration and field operations for Project Management Integration.
Expertise in data analysis. Involvement in work management, quality and project safety requirements. Involved in cost, schedule and procurement activities. Field work.
Requirements
Bachelor's degree in Engineering. 2-5-year experience in energy sector.
Certified Associate in Project Management or Project Management Professional Certification (requested).
Proficient in Microsoft Project, Excel, PowerPoint, and Word.
Experience in the functional area under which it will be contracted: Substations, T&D, Gas-Hydro and OSG.
Salary Range: $59,100.00 - $70,900.00 per year.
The specific salary offered may be influenced by a variety of factors including but not limited to the candidate's relevant experience, education, and work location.
